Serial Port 2 / 3 Mode

These settings specify the transmission mode of the Serial Port 2 & 3.

RS-422 defines a Balanced (differential) interface, specifying a single, unidirectional driver with multiple receivers (up to 32). RS-422 will sup- port Point-to-Point,

Multi-Drop circuits, but not Multi-Point.

RS-485 defines a Balanced (differential) interface, specifying bidirec- tional, half-duplex data transmission. Up to 32 transmitters and 32 receiv- ers may be interconnected in any combination, including one driver and multiple receivers (multi- drop), or one receiver and multiple drivers.
